Monster Kingdom - Jewel Summoner by Atlus/Gaia, released in 2006 in Japan and 2007 in the West. A turn-based RPG with monster-jewel capture. Vance investigates his father's death in a fantasy world with numerous creatures to collect.

Capturing and evolving jewel-monsters to solve a murder: this Atlus J-RPG marries creature collecting with investigation in a dark, adult world. Its uneven pace and modest presentation pushed it to the background. But its mature atmosphere and capture system will please fans of collector-style RPGs.
